Mouse

Gpsm1 - G-protein signalling modulator 1 (AGS3-like, C. elegans)

Predicted to enable G-protein alpha-subunit binding activity and GDP-dissociation inhibitor activity. Predicted to be involved in positive regulation of macroautophagy; regulation of G protein-coupled receptor signaling pathway; and regulation of GTPase activity. Predicted to act upstream of or within cell differentiation and nervous system development. Predicted to be located in plasma membrane. Predicted to be part of protein-containing complex. Predicted to colocalize with Golgi membrane; cell cortex; and endoplasmic reticulum membrane. Is expressed in several structures, including central nervous system; genitourinary system; gut; integumental system; and peripheral nervous system ganglion. Orthologous to human GPSM1 (G protein signaling modulator 1). [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, Apr 2022]
